Output 108f93b6ab568a6930cb4a608faa2ecbe4c29e914e22fdb1bdaea6a84657d57d:42

value
102150
script pubkey
OP_0 OP_PUSHBYTES_20 c90b51bc3a8115f4deb1217b94337081a692ad1f
address
bc1qey94r0p6sy2lfh43y9aegvmssxnf9tglxjra6a
transaction
108f93b6ab568a6930cb4a608faa2ecbe4c29e914e22fdb1bdaea6a84657d57d
spent
true